The Support class is the backbone of most Battlefield 6 squads, but you need to complete challenges to unlock its most important features. Battlefield 6's Support challenges are quite a grind, too, so you'll have to play a lot of multiplayer matches to unlock everything.
Support isn't the only class that works like this in Battlefield 6, either. Each of the four classes has its own set of challenges that unlock important gadgets like C4 Explosives and Deploy Beacons. To make the most of your favorite class, you should get these done as soon as possible. Here's how to complete every Support challenge in Battlefield 6.

All Support Class Challenges in Battlefield 6
There are three Support challenges to complete in Battlefield 6. These are unlocked after reaching Rank 20 in multiplayer.

These are straightforward challenges that you can complete just by playing Support normally. As long as you use your gadgets like Deployable Cover and the Smoke Grenade Launcher unlocked from the first challenge, you shouldn't have any problems getting these three challenges completed. Stick close to your squad and keep their ammo and health topped off for the best results.
All Support Specialist Challenges in Battlefield 6
There are three Support Specialist challenges to complete in Battlefield 6. You can only start working on these after you complete the first three Support challenges.

These challenges are tougher, but the rewards are worth the effort. You just have to keep using Support gadgets. It can be tough to intercept projectiles with the Grenade Intercept System, so try to play objective-based game modes on smaller maps where enemies are more likely to spam grenades.
The final challenge requires you to revive 75 teammates in a match, which is a huge undertaking. Make sure you play modes with lengthy average match times so you can find that many people. Breakthrough is a solid choice since your entire team will be bunched up together, but you can also go with Conquest as long as you stick to hotly-contested flags.
Once you complete all of these challenges, you'll have access to incredibly important Support gadgets like the Supply Pouch. These gadgets are a key part of the best Battlefield 6 Support loadouts.
